SophiaRose said:i'm wondering when they initate the braid, do the
A-use one large piece of hair and keep leaving out strands, or do they
B- continually add hair, as they braid, thus leaving out hair along the way???
trimbride said:They continually add loose hair to the cornrow. It is like a tree with branches.
But I must emphasize treating your hair like silk when you are in these. No tight ponytails and silk scarfs are a must.
I didn't know anybetter and suffered from the worst traction alopecia I have ever seen in my entire life. I thought my hairline wouldn't grow back. It was very traumatic, but as you can see from my album I recovered.
